Key Factors to Consider when Choosing a Coffee Grinder for Espresso

When venturing into the world of espresso brewing, several key considerations come into play when selecting the ideal coffee grinder. These factors can make a substantial difference in the quality and consistency of your espresso shots:

Burr Type (conical vs. flat)

Burr grinders are favored for espresso grinding due to their ability to produce uniform particle size. Conical burrs are known for their efficiency in retaining flavor profiles, while flat burrs offer precision in grind size adjustment.

Grind Consistency

Consistent grind size is crucial for a balanced extraction and the perfect crema in espresso. A grinder capable of producing uniform particles ensures even extraction of flavors from the coffee grounds.

Grind Size Adjustment

Espresso brewing demands precision in grind size, as even a slight variation can alter the taste of the final brew. Grinders with stepless or digital grind size adjustment provide the control needed for dialing in the perfect espresso.

Capacity

Consider the volume of coffee beans your grinder can hold and grind at once. For espresso brewing, a grinder with a suitable capacity for single or double shots is ideal to maintain freshness in each dose.

Features (e.g., doserless, portafilter holder)

Additional features like doserless designs, portafilter holders, and programmable dosing can enhance the convenience and efficiency of the grinding process, especially in a busy espresso setup.

Frequently Asked Questions

What factors should I consider when choosing a coffee grinder for espresso?

When selecting a coffee grinder for espresso, consider factors such as grind size consistency, grinder type (burr or blade), durability, ease of cleaning, and price.

Can I use a blade grinder for making espresso?

While a blade grinder can technically grind coffee beans for espresso, it may not provide the consistent grind size needed for quality espresso. Burr grinders are generally preferred for espresso brewing.

Are manual coffee grinders suitable for making espresso?

Yes, manual coffee grinders can work well for making espresso. They offer precision control over the grind size and are often compact and portable, making them a great option for espresso enthusiasts.

Do I need to spend a lot of money to get a good espresso grinder?

You don’t necessarily have to spend a fortune to get a good espresso grinder. There are budget-friendly options available that can still deliver excellent grind quality for making delicious espresso at home.
